Building company puts on the pink to support breast cancer awareness

Builders are adding a dash of colour with their clothing at one West Yorkshire site, to show support for Breast Cancer Awareness Month.

Workers at Barratt Homes Yorkshire West's Ashmeade Park development in Pontefract put on bright pink protective headwear and high visibility jackets for ‘Wear it Pink’ on October 20.

The Wear it Pink campaign raises around £2million during Breast Cancer Awareness Month each year and has made over £30 million since it began in 2002.

Donna Hampton, sales adviser at Ashmeade Park, said: “We’re delighted to show our support for Breast Cancer Awareness Month this October. The campaign raises so much money for charity each year, it is fantastic to be involved and the lads really do look quite dashing in pink! We’ll be collecting on site for the rest of the month, so welcome any donations from the local community.”
